The role
The educator plays a crucial role in supporting the daily operations of a kindergarten program ensuring a safe engaging and nurturing environment for children. This position involves preparing materials setting up activity areas and supervising children throughout the day. The assistant is responsible for maintaining cleanliness and organization in indoor and outdoor play areas ensuring the safety of equipment and responding to minor injuries.
As Wodonga Council Services look to the Best Start Best Life reform changes and program hours increasing we are growing our workforce team. This is an exciting time to join our team with additional supports and training opportunities available to help staff feel prepared and confident to meet the changes commencing in our LGA from 2026.
Key aspects of the role include the following;
- Interact with children all interactions have an educational role being aware that children are learning attitudes, absorbing ideas, imitating language and using the Educator as a model Interactions include enjoying helping encouraging and responding to children.
- Enrich the program by observing and contributing ideas talents resources which can be a valuable addition to the program
- Observe confidentiality at all times with regard to children and their families as well as any other care and education matter.
- Work cooperatively with the teacher under their direction and guidance and contribute ideas and skills to the program.
- Ensure that the program continues to function in other areas while the teacher concentrates on small groups of children for specific learning experiences.
